for the coat, I bought one of these:
http://fidelitypeacoat.com/

keep in mind though, that dark navy pretty much means black. It's quite warm, fits nice and snug for me (I bought a 32). On my the cut isn't very traditional, it's actually slim fitting and cuts in a little but at my natural waist. I'm sure that's just because I'm small and sized down one on chest so that my arms fit well though.

Similar to the fidelity is : http://www.schottnyc.com/products/lifestyle/military/classic-32-oz-melton-wool.htm

More expensive but more color selection.

both are the same style as the one made for the US Navy. Not 100% wool (recycled at that) but for the price, the fidelity is very good, at least to me.
